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77 9778383 70159969565 581
5832679257 75 626269
5832679257 75 626269
01 22566452 47 27 882441
All about undefined
Interested in learning more?
5832679257 75 626269
01 22566452 47 27 882441
See more
407 732168
9586 24 512 593
See more
308270047 81
47553828043 557 001791 1073
See more